U.S. General's Admission of Military Vulnerability Against Iran 🔹 In a rare admission, "James P. Eisenhower," Commander of the U.S. Army Combined Arms Command, stated that Iran's attacks are a factor in changing the operational methods of the U.S. Army, saying that Washington needs to learn again how to "hide" from the enemy's view after years of relying on secure and centralized bases. 🔗Read the full report here.
